In den WarenkorbHardcover. Zustand: new. Hardcover. The book is designed for undergraduates, graduates, and researchers of mathematics studying fixed point theory or nonlinear analysis. It deals with the fixed point theory for not only single-valued maps but also set-valued maps. The text is divided into three parts: fixed point theory for single-valued mappings, continuity and fixed point aspects of set-valued analysis, and variational principles and their equilibrium problems. It comprises a comprehensive study of these topics and includes all important results derived from them. The applications of fixed point principles and variational principles, and their generalizations to differential equations and optimization are covered in the text. An elementary treatment of the theory of equilibrium problems and equilibrium version of Ekeland's variational principle is also provided. New topics such as equilibrium problems, variational principles, Caristi's fixed point theorem, and Takahashi's minimization theorem with their applications are also included. The book is designed for undergraduates, graduates, and researchers of mathematics studying fixed point theory or nonlinear analysis. Basic techniques and results of topics such as fixed point theory, set-valued analysis, variational principles, and equilibrium problems are presented in an understandable and thorough manner. In den WarenkorbBuch. Zustand: Neu. Neuware - 'The fixed-point theory in metric spaces came into the existence through the PhD work of Polish mathematician Stefan Banach in 1920. The outcome of the Banach contraction principle became the initial source of the theory. It evolved with time and is now important not only for nonlinear analysis but also for many other branches of mathematics. It has also been applied to sciences and engineering. Many extensions and generalizations of the Banach contraction principle are explored by mathematicians. The proposed book covers some of the main extensions and generalizations of the principle. It focuses on the basic techniques and results of topics like set-valued analysis, variational principles, and equilibrium problems. This book will be useful for researchers working in nonlinear analysis and optimization and can be a reference book for graduate and undergraduate students. There are some excellent books available on metric fixed point theory, but the above-mentioned topics are not covered in any single resource. The book includes a brief introduction to set-valued analysis with a focus on continuity and the fixed-point theory of set-valued maps and the last part of the book focuses on the application of fixed point theory'--.
